Transaction 8fff13c7c673200213c6c5b82c34a2498705c0955509ce9432739f191ee334ea
1 Input
1 Output
-
8fff13c7c673200213c6c5b82c34a2498705c0955509ce9432739f191ee334ea:0
- value
- 19983530
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d3e4088569b752584bed73d30d76d645d1ff413b4a251f97e8b68c94ed3723e4
- address
- bc1p60jq3ptfkaf9sjldw0fs6akkghgl7sfmfgj3l9lgk6xffmfhy0jqhc2slw